Abstract

This paper examines the influence of social media and digital communication environments on the linguistic and formal transformations of contemporary Romanian poetry. It argues that poetic discourse is increasingly shaped by the speed, aesthetics, and interactional norms of online platforms such as Instagram, where literary production circulates in hybridized and highly accessible forms. Drawing on theoretical perspectives from internet linguistics, posthumanist studies and digital literary studies, this article analyzes the emergence of new poetic registers marked by abbreviation, emotive symbols or informal syntax. The study combines conceptual analysis with close readings of a selected corpus consisting of the volumes Softboi mimosa by Tudor Pop and poems published on Instagram by Vlad Drăgoi. These case studies demonstrate how digital environments reshape poetic voice, textual materiality, and author–reader relations, while simultaneously challenging conventional distinctions between literature, everyday discourse, and mediated self-performance. Thus, I will show that contemporary Romanian poetry is undergoing significant reconfiguration under the pressure of a networked culture and that digitally disseminated poetry should be recognized as a legitimate and necessary object of literary and linguistic inquiry.
